生活科学编程课程内容是什么
-
生活科学编程课程内容主要包括以下方面:
-
编程基础知识:学习编程语言的基本概念、语法和常用工具。包括变量、数据类型、运算符、条件语句、循环语句等基础知识。
-
数据分析与可视化:学习如何使用编程语言处理和分析数据,包括数据清洗、数据处理和数据可视化。学习使用常用的数据分析库和可视化工具。
-
机器学习与人工智能:学习机器学习和人工智能的基本概念和算法,包括监督学习、无监督学习、深度学习等。学习如何使用编程语言实现机器学习和人工智能算法。
-
网络爬虫与数据挖掘:学习如何使用编程语言编写网络爬虫程序,从网页中提取数据,并进行数据挖掘和分析。
-
自动化与物联网:学习如何使用编程语言控制硬件设备,实现自动化和物联网应用。学习如何使用传感器、执行器和微控制器等硬件设备。
-
网站开发与移动应用开发:学习如何使用编程语言开发网站和移动应用。学习前端开发和后端开发的基本知识和技术。
-
创新项目实践:通过实践项目,学习如何应用编程知识解决实际问题。学习项目管理和团队协作的基本原则。
生活科学编程课程旨在培养学生的计算思维能力和创新能力,让他们能够运用编程知识解决生活中的问题,并为将来的学习和工作打下坚实的基础。
1年前 -
-
生活科学编程课程的内容主要涵盖以下几个方面:
-
编程基础知识:学习编程语言的基础知识,包括变量、数据类型、运算符、流程控制语句等。学生将通过编写简单的程序来理解编程的基本原理和逻辑。
-
数据分析与可视化:学习使用编程语言进行数据分析和可视化的技术。包括数据收集、清洗、处理、分析和展示等方面的内容。学生将学习如何使用编程语言处理大量数据,并通过可视化的方式将数据呈现出来,以便更好地理解和分析数据。
-
机器学习与人工智能:介绍机器学习和人工智能的基本概念和原理,学习如何使用编程语言实现一些简单的机器学习算法和人工智能应用。学生将通过实践项目来加深对机器学习和人工智能的理解。
-
网络编程与应用开发:学习网络编程的基本知识,包括网络协议、网络通信、网络安全等方面的内容。学生将学习如何使用编程语言来开发网络应用,如网页开发、服务器端开发等。
-
创新项目实践:在课程的最后阶段,学生将有机会参与一个创新项目实践。通过实践项目,学生将运用所学的编程知识和技术,解决实际问题或开发创新应用。这将帮助学生巩固所学的知识,并培养创新思维和实践能力。
此外,生活科学编程课程还可能涉及其他相关领域的知识,如计算机基础、算法与数据结构、软件工程等。课程内容会根据学校或机构的具体安排而有所不同,以上内容仅为一般性介绍。
1年前 -
-
生活科学编程课程是一门结合生活科学与编程的课程,旨在让学生通过编程的方式,探索并解决实际生活中的问题。这门课程的内容包括以下几个方面:
-
编程基础知识:介绍编程的基本概念和语法,包括变量、数据类型、条件语句、循环语句等。学生将学会使用编程语言来编写简单的程序。
-
生活科学知识:引入一些与生活相关的科学知识,如物理、化学、生物等。通过学习这些知识,学生能够更好地理解生活中的现象和问题,并将其应用到编程中。
-
生活问题解决:通过编程实践,学生将学会使用编程解决实际生活中的问题。例如,学生可以通过编写程序来计算日常生活中的开销、制作健康饮食计划、优化旅行路线等。
-
数据处理与分析:学生将学会使用编程语言处理和分析生活中的数据。例如,学生可以通过编写程序来分析购物清单中的物品价格、分析健身记录中的运动数据等。
-
创意项目开发:学生将有机会进行创意项目的开发。他们可以选择一个生活中的问题,然后运用所学的编程知识来设计和实现解决方案。例如,可以开发一个智能家居系统、一个健康管理应用等。
在学习过程中,学生将通过课堂讲解、实践编程、小组讨论等方式来掌握知识。同时,教师会提供指导和反馈,帮助学生解决遇到的问题,并培养学生的创新思维和解决问题的能力。
总之,生活科学编程课程旨在将编程与生活科学结合起来,通过编程解决实际生活中的问题,培养学生的创新能力和解决问题的思维方式。通过这门课程的学习,学生不仅可以提高编程技能,还能更好地理解和应用生活科学知识。
1年前 -